pytorch的代码 CPU改为GPU
找一下几个地方改动

  • 网络模型
  • 数据(输入、标记)
  • 损失函数
  • cuda()

一、网络模型

mymodule = MyModule()
mymodule = mymodule.cuda()

二、数据(输入、标记)

        images,targets = dataimages = images.cuda()targets = targets.cuda() #训练数据和测试数据集都要进行此操作

三、损失函数

# 损失函数
loss = nn.CrossEntropyLoss()
loss = loss.cuda()

上面的写法,在无GPU时会报错。更好的写法是有GPU用GPU,无GPU用CPU

mymodule = MyModule()
if torch.cuda.is_available():mymodule = mymodule.cuda()

pytorch的代码 CPU改为GPU相关推荐

  1. Tensorflow + PyTorch 安装(CPU + GPU 版本)

    目录 一.Anaconda 安装 二.安装 TensorFlow-CPU 1.配置环境 2.安装 Tensorflow 三.安装TensorFlow-GPU 1.是否可安装GPU版Tensorflow ...

  2. Pytorch:比较CPU和GPU的运算速度

    在跑神经网络的时候,GPU的作用是很明显的.下面比较一下CPU跑和GPU跑的区别: 先用CPU跑: import torch import timefor i in range(1,10):start ...

  3. PyTorch 笔记(03)— Tensor 数据类型分类(默认数据类型、CPU tensor、GPU tensor、CPU 和 GPU 之间的转换、数据类型之间转换)

    1. Tensor 数据类型 Tensor 有不同的数据类型,如下表所示,每种类型都有 CPU 和 GPU 版本(HalfTensor)除外,默认的 tensor 是数据类型是 FloatTensor ...

  4. 收藏!PyTorch常用代码段合集

    ↑↑↑关注后"星标"Datawhale 每日干货 & 每月组队学习,不错过 Datawhale干货 作者:Jack Stark,来源:极市平台 来源丨https://zhu ...

  5. PyTorch常用代码段合集

    ↑ 点击蓝字 关注视学算法 作者丨Jack Stark@知乎 来源丨https://zhuanlan.zhihu.com/p/104019160 极市导读 本文是PyTorch常用代码段合集,涵盖基本 ...

  6. 【深度学习】PyTorch常用代码段合集

    来源 | 极市平台,机器学习算法与自然语言处理 本文是PyTorch常用代码段合集,涵盖基本配置.张量处理.模型定义与操作.数据处理.模型训练与测试等5个方面,还给出了多个值得注意的Tips,内容非常 ...

  7. pytorch list转tensor_PyTorch 52.PyTorch常用代码段合集

    本文参考于: Jack Stark:[深度学习框架]PyTorch常用代码段​zhuanlan.zhihu.com 1. 基本配置 导入包和版本查询: import torch import torc ...

  8. 收藏 | PyTorch常用代码段合集

    点上方蓝字计算机视觉联盟获取更多干货 在右上方 ··· 设为星标 ★,与你不见不散 仅作学术分享,不代表本公众号立场,侵权联系删除 转载于:作者丨Jack Stark@知乎 来源丨https://zh ...

  9. 深度盘点:PyTorch常用代码段合集

    本文是PyTorch常用代码段合集,涵盖基本配置.张量处理.模型定义与操作.数据处理.模型训练与测试等5个方面,还给出了多个值得注意的Tips,内容非常全面. PyTorch最好的资料是官方文档.本文 ...

最新文章

  1. 实战centos6安装zabbix-2.4版(终极版)
  2. 关于jQuery获取Action返回的JSON数据 项目真实案例 记录(Struts2)
  3. Tomcat相关面试题,看这篇就够了!保证能让面试官颤抖!
  4. Fork_Join - Java多线程编程
  5. Android Studio之导入安卓项目gradle编译出现问题分析日志思路
  6. 鸿蒙os2.0公测机型,鸿蒙OS2.0第二期第三期公测机型陆续公布 麒麟980和麒麟820将登场...
  7. javascript本地,宿主,内置对象
  8. Git-github 的基本应用
  9. 1.GNUradio 的环境搭建
  10. bootstrap——强大的网页设计元素模板
  11. 为什么机器学习在投资领域不好使
  12. 和计算机与设计相关的,计算机设计和类论文参考文献 计算机设计和参考文献有哪些...
  13. 完美解决Tensorflow不支持AVX2指令集问题|指令集加速
  14. CentOS 8 部署禅道,并使用自己的数据库
  15. 好奇那些进了大厂的程序员面试前都做了哪些准备?Android大厂面试官全套教程教你:这样准备面试顺利拿到offer
  16. 头像照片汇聚logo视频片头ae竖屏模板
  17. 奔涌吧 后浪!!! 哔哩哔哩 何冰
  18. 【cookbook pandas】学习笔记 chapter9 grouping,aggregation,filtration,and transformation
  19. Python ACM模式
  20. 教学生用计算机画画,教师资格证美术面试真题《用电脑画画》

热门文章

  1. PTA_L1-054 福到了 (15分)
  2. 2021年,企业做好电商的六大关键点
  3. 什么是前端宏任务,什么又是前端微任务呢?一文读懂前端微任务宏任务。
  4. python判断一个列表是否包含另一个列表_Python判断一个list中是否包含另一个list全部元素的方法分析...
  5. Auto.js软件工具集合
  6. 如何获取国外动态住宅ip并使用?
  7. 网页漂浮物代码_无代码VS低代码。 有什么不同? 它。 不。 物。
  8. Raspberry Pi 4B树莓派 |#入门教程02# 树莓派GPIO控制(Python、C)
  9. iverilog 提示 Unknown module type 解决办法
  10. 董明珠回应“对赌”:格力与小米没有可比性